
More about LogTag® TRIX-8 Multi-Use Temperature Recorder
Ideal for poultry producers, the LogTag TRIX-8 Multi-Use Temperature Recorder allows you to keep a close eye on your egg and chick transport trucks' temperature levels. This recorder has a unique external temperature sensor that reacts to temperature changes. About the size of a credit card, this reader gives you the capabilities to record and monitor temperature in your barn, warehouse, transport trucks or any place where temperature data is important.
Enclosed in a robust and durable polycarbonate case, the TRIX-8 features a real-time clock, which provides date/time stamps for each temperature recording. Using the LogTag Interface and freely available companion software LogTag Analyzer, the LogTag is easily set up for recording conditions including delayed start, sampling interval, number of readings, continuous or fixed number of readings and configuration of conditions to activate the ALERT indicator.
Recordings are downloaded using a LogTag USB Interface Cradle, QC Part #10875, sold separately. The cradle provides facilities for charting, zooming, listing data statistics and allows exporting the data to other applications like Excel.
The TRIX-8 complies with the relevant international standards for temperature monitoring devices, such as FCC, CE, C-TICK, TÜV, EN12830, WHO PQS and RoHS. This demonstrates the quality of the TRIX-8 and underlies its suitability for temperature monitoring applications where accuracy and consistency is required.
This recorder is reusable and accurate with large memory and programmable parameters.
Specifications
- Sampling Frequency: Adjustable from 30 seconds to several hours
- Operating Range: -40° F to 185° F; -40° C to 85° C
- Memory Size: 8,031 temperature readings. 53 days @ 10 min logging; 80 days @ 15 min logging
- Download Time: Typically less than 5 sec for full memory, depending on computer or readout device used
- Recorder Size: 3.5" x 2.2" x 0.5"
- Weight: 2 oz
- Battery Life: 2-3 years of normal use - based on 15 min logging, download data monthly
- Sensor Reaction Time: Typically less than 5 min (T90) in moving air (1 m/s)
- Environmental: IP65 - roughly equivalent to NEMA 4
- Power Source: 3V Li-Mg battery
